Why This Matters Across Episodes
The longer arc this connection carries
In Episode 106, Chapuys speaks of 'the princess' and acts as her advocate, while Cromwell is preoccupied with Anne Boleyn. In Episode 201, Cromwell uses that same relationship to pressure Mary, demonstrating continuity in the political dynamic and Cromwell's strategic use of Chapuys as an intermediary.
